Summer is here and if you’re wondering where you can enjoy some outside drinks of an evening in Leicester, here’s our guide to the best beer and cocktail gardens and terraces in town.

Brick & Beam

This roof terrace is such a little hidden gem. Tucked away on Queen Street in the Cultural Quarter, Brick & Beam is a perfect spot for after work drinks or to start your night out. A great cocktail selection and look out for their latest live music events.

Bruxelles & Apres Lounge

bruxelles Leicester

If you’re looking to keep the outdoor drinks going well into the night then Bruxelles and Apres Lounge is the way to go, with their joint courtyard at the back of the neighbouring venues. With an outdoor bar and outdoor DJ booth open into the early hours it’s the best place to head for an outdoor party, but get down early if you want a table as later on it’s full of people dancing.

The Soundhouse

soundhouse leicester

The Soundhouse has music fans sorted this summer as they’ll be running the Summer Sessions every Saturday and Sunday afternoon until September. Yes, this means there’ll be acoustic acts on their outdoor stage in the garden all weekend with free entry. The garden is just undergoing a full spruce up too, so we’re looking forward to seeing what’s in store!

Rutland & Derby

rutland and derby leicester

Whether having something to eat at the start of the evening, or grabbing a seat for drinks through the night, the 2 level terrace at the Rutland & Derby is perfect. Find yourself a table outside or head up the spiral staircase to their astro-turf covered roof terrace. (Also pictured in feature image)

The King’s Head

kings head

Just at the bottom of New Walk, this unsuspecting pub offers a little more than you realise. Grab a gin or a beer and head up the stairs to their roof terrace where you can even watch sport on the outdoor telly.

Tamatanga

tamatanga leicester

Can we class this as a terrace? Well they do 2 for 1 cocktails every day so we’re going to! Head down to Tamatanga on Shires Lane at Highcross and grab one of their outdoor tables at the front to enjoy their tasty cocktail menu with double the fun, as happy hour runs from 12pm – 7pm every day of the week.
